Ingredients for Homemade Rice-A-Roni
- 1/2 Cup White or Brown Rice
- 1/4 Cup Spaghetti or gluten-free spaghetti, broken in small pieces
- 1 Tablespoon Butter
- 1 1/2 Cup Chicken Stock (if following a gluten-free diet, make sure you choose gluten-free stock)
- 1 Teaspoon Salt
- 1 Teaspoon Garlic Powder
- 1 Teaspoon Oregano
How to Make Rice-A-Roni
- Melt the butter in a large saucepan.
- Add rice and pasta on medium-high heat.
- Toast the rice and pasta while stirring until golden brown.
- Add remaining ingredients.
- Cover with a lid and simmer for 25-35 minutes until or pasta and rice are tender.
- Additional butter may be added if desired.
- Stir and serve this delicious side dish.
Does rice have gluten?
We are often asked if there is gluten in rice. The good news is, all rice is gluten-free! This includes all varieties, brown rice, white rice, and wild rice.
Even Asian or sticky rice, also called “glutinous rice,” is gluten-free. We like to refer to this list of naturally gluten-free foods when picking ingredients for gluten free recipes like this one.
Tips for Gluten-Free Recipe for Rice-A-Roni
- Use a gluten-free spaghetti noodle if following a gluten-free diet. For a typical Rice-A-Roni, a vermicelli pasta is used. However, the gluten-free versions of this thin pasta tend to fall apart before the rice is cooked, so we recommend a spaghetti noodle.
- Brown rice will make your gluten-free Rice-a-Roni even healthier, adding more fiber than traditional white rice.
- Cook the rice in chicken stock; this will give that comforting flavor found in the box mixes.
- Use a low sodium chicken stock, as you don’t want it to get too salty while the rice cooks!
- If following a gluten-free diet, look for gluten-free chicken stock.
Can I freeze Rice-A-Roni?
Yes. Our homemade Rice-A-Roni freezes perfectly. Just add any extras in a freezer Ziploc bag and freeze for up to one month. When you have a busy night, just defrost and microwave.
What kind of rice is best in Rice-A-Roni?
Traditional Rice-A-Roni calls for long-grain white rice, alongside with the vermicelli or spaghetti. I happen to love Uncle Ben’s rice, the long grain rice which is parboiled, but you can use any rice you prefer.

Rice-A-Roni One-Pot Meal
We just love the versatility of this dish! You can easily make this a one-pot meal by adding your favorite protein and mix up the flavors.
Or by adding a few additional ingredients that take the deliciousness up to another level. Try making Rice-A-Roni Spanish rice by adding some sauteéd peppers and onions and a couple of dashes of paprika.
